Responsibilities
- Assist the team through all phases of a client engagement including work planning, mobilization, execution, and closeout consistent with established program delivery processes to meet the scope, schedule, budget, and other contract requirements.
- Ensure that the scope of work is completed to the satisfaction of the client and key stakeholders, while simultaneously ensuring that quality, financial, risk management, business and policy expectations are met.
- Communicate and work on a variety of assignments potentially including progress and status, scope, schedule, and budget as well as progress of deliverables, client reviews, technical input, and comment resolution.
- Ensure compliance with applicable policies and procedures, laws and regulations, and keeps current on compliance-related areas.
- Perform research for technical accounting issues as appropriate; formulates resolution of issues identified through the research process.
- May provide on-site, virtual or augmented business services for client.
- Participate in the preparation of deliverables/reports for review that include any noted issues, trends and other micro/macro level risks identified through the execution of activities.
- Provide support on other consulting projects, as necessary.
- Proactively communicates any issues/concerns relating to assignments.
- Prepares for relevant certification exams until completed and maintains the required CPE for firm and licensing requirements.
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ance or related field
- 3+ years of relevant accounting or auditing experience or within an outsourced accounting team
Preferred/Desired Qualifications
- CPA or pursuing CPA certification
- Ability to learn and understand new concepts, workflows, and software applications
- Highly organized with strong attention to detail
- Perform effectively, efficiently and with quality under tight deadlines and manages multiple priorities
- Excellent interpersonal, written, and verbal communication skills
- Demonstrate a positive attitude, proactive nature, and be receptive to feedback
- Exhibit professionalism and maintain the highest level of confidentiality
- Able to work independently with minimal supervision and within a team environment
- Technically proficient with the capability of performing at an intermediate or advanced level with respect to the Microsoft Office Suite of products (specifically Excel, and Word, Outlook)
